ELIZAVILLE
Frank Fingar died very suddenly on Tuesday morning of this week. His father had left him only a short time, before, and reported at the post office that Frank, had spent a rather uncomfortable night, but was much better then. Mr Fingar left the office soon after, and had been gone only a short time when word came that Frank had just expired. Thus has ended the life of a promising young man. Only lately married, his temporal prospects very fair and life's joys apparently awaiting his partaking. He suffered much, but the last days of his suffering were characterized with patience and submission to God's will. He died in the blessed hope of a blissful immortality
